ZIP 82925 and ZIP 82935 are ZIP Code areas in Wyoming.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 82935 has the higher population (12,135 vs 373 in ZIP 82925). ZIP 82925 has the higher median household income ($250,001 vs $86,132 in ZIP 82935). ZIP 82925 has the higher median home value ($416,300 vs $254,800 in ZIP 82935).
